What Is a Sensory Light Board?

A sensory light board is an illuminated activity panel designed to stimulate visual and tactile senses. The board typically contains LED lighting behind a surface where users can place translucent objects such as pegs, rods, or shapes.

When these elements are inserted into the board, the light shines through them, creating glowing colors and patterns. This transforms the panel into an engaging combination of light wall art, interactive wall activity, and sensory exploration.

Many modern sensory environments use vertical boards such as a light peg board instead of traditional flat light tables because wall-mounted systems save space and allow multiple users to interact at the same time.

How Does a LED Peg Board Work?

A LED peg board works through a simple but effective design. Behind the surface of the board is an evenly distributed LED lighting system that illuminates the panel.

The board contains a grid of holes where translucent elements such as acrylic rods can be inserted. When these rods enter the holes, the light travels through them and creates bright glowing colors.

In large installations such as a giant LED peg wall, users can build patterns, shapes, and colorful designs while exploring the visual effects created by light and transparency.

Benefits of Sensory Light Boards

Interactive light panels offer many developmental benefits. Because users must place each element carefully, they encourage both creative thinking and fine motor coordination.

A well-designed sensory peg wall helps develop:

  • fine motor skills
  • hand-eye coordination
  • pattern recognition
  • color exploration
  • creative expression

For this reason, sensory specialists often recommend light-based tools as part of sensory board autism activities and sensory integration therapy.

Where Sensory Light Boards Are Used

Sensory Rooms

In professional sensory rooms, visual stimulation is an important part of therapy and relaxation. A glowing sensory light board provides a calming visual experience while encouraging gentle interaction.

Schools and Learning Environments

Many modern classrooms use sensory boards to create interactive learning spaces. A light peg board allows students to experiment with colors and patterns while developing creative thinking skills.

Waiting Rooms and Clinics

Healthcare facilities and clinics often use wall-mounted sensory panels as waiting room toys. Because they are fixed to the wall, they reduce clutter and provide a safe and engaging activity for children.

Playrooms and Creative Spaces

At home or in play centers, a glowing interactive wall becomes a centerpiece of creativity. Children can experiment with colors and design their own glowing artwork using acrylic rods.
